SeDiv is a professional-grade software suite specifically designed for diagnosing, repairing, and servicing hard disk drives (HDDs). Unlike standard data recovery programs that focus on retrieving lost files, SeDiv operates at a much deeper, firmware level. This allows technicians to address the root causes of a mechanical hard drive's failure, such as corrupted firmware, bad sector maps, and malfunctioning read/write heads.

| Feature Category | Specific Capabilities | |----------------|------------------------| | Drive Support | Seagate F3 architecture (Barracuda 7200.11, 7200.12, DM Series, etc.) | | Terminal Access | Full TTL command set via USB-to-TTL adapter | | Firmware Operations | Read/write modules, head maps, SA (System Area) access | | Defect Management | P-list editing, G-list transfer, pending sector repair | | SMART Management | Reset SMART logs, clear offline data | | Unlocking & Passwords | Remove ATA passwords, unlock user-locked drives | | ROM Operations | Read, write, repair ROM data | | Background Scanning | Check for bad sectors without conventional full format |
